Irka Mateo is a Dominican cultural treasure. Irka’s roots are as an indigenous Taino woman. She sings and writes songs inspired in the Taino/Afro/European folk of her native Dominican Republic while incorporating the wider influences of her multicultural background. Her trailblazing work includes prolific output as an artist and folklorist. Her love for the Dominican peasant population, bearers of the most ancient culture, led her to travel ten years in the rural areas of her country documenting more that thirteen genres of folk musical traditions and Taino culture. Her extensive field research of Dominican folk music was recognized by the Grammy Foundation and brought to life in her critically acclaimed record, Anacaona. As a singer/songwriter she has created her original music inspired in the Dominican folklore and has played with her band in venues and festivals around the Americas. Her current work, including the single “Vamo a Goza,” showcases the contagious accordion music from the Dominican Republic and Latin America. With an amazing voice, colorful songs, and outstanding performance, Irka Mateo fills the dance floors with her joyful music.

Health professionals recently reported that meth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A), which is the form of Staphylococcus aureus that is antibiotic resistant and widespread throughout healthcare facilities in the U.S., livestock, communities and environments, is increasing the severity of antibiotic-resistant illnesses.
The current rates of MRSA invasive infections have decreased in healthcare facilities, but the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) state that it is because the CDC has tracked only invasive MRSA infections. This means that the true rates of MRSA infections are significantly under-reported. Additionally, community-acquired MRSA (CA-MRSA) infection rates are neither tracked nor reported and are rising.
A 2013 USA Today investigation showed that the 80,500 invasive MRSA cases reported by the CDC in 2011 vastly underrepresented the diseases; approximately six times (460,000) as many hospitalizations actually involve MRSA. In 2011, approximately 23,000 people died from MRSA.
CA-MRSA infections have steadily risen. More than 50 percent of skin infections within the U.S. are caused by MRSA. There has not been surveillance or reporting of CA-MRSA, and MRSA continues to be an epidemic.
“The ongoing MRSA epidemic is fueling antibiotic resistance globally as antibiotics are used indiscriminately in humans and in livestock,” Jeanine Thomas, founder of MRSA Survivors Network, said. “Antimicrobial resistance (AMR) is a current and dangerous public health crisis.”

“From slavery and the days of Jim Crow through the civil rights movement and beyond, white supremacists have targeted the Black church because of its importance as a pillar of the Black community, the center for leadership and institution building, education, social and political development and organizing to fight oppression,” Love wrote.
“Strike at the Black church, and you strike at the heart of Black American life,” the writer added.
The most recent fires occurred early today at the Glover Grover Baptist Church, in Warrenville, S.C., and at the Greater Miracle Apostolic Holiness Church in Tallahassee, Fla.
Federal agents have been brought in to assist local officials in determining the unknown cause of the fire at the Glover Grove Baptist church. In Tallahassee, fire officials say the fire that totally destroyed the Apostolic Holiness Church may have been caused by a tree limb falling on overhead electrical lines.
